Job description

Veterinary Reception, Animal Care Attendant

Toronto, ON

Schedule: Full-time, Flexible

Secord Animal Hospital welcomes an experienced Veterinary Receptionist and Animal Care Attendant to join our team! This is an exceptional full-time opportunity for an organized, motivated, and empathetic individual to support our hospital operations. In this role, you will help our clients and their pets feel welcomed and appreciated.

Requirements include excellent customer service skills, a genuine aptitude for putting pets and pet parents at ease, and creating a welcoming environment.

Key qualities:

  • Remaining calm and adaptable in stressful situations
  • Willingness to learn about veterinary services, updated medical office procedures, and assist veterinary staff with various tasks and treatments
  • Ability to answer a multiline phone system and efficiently schedule appointments, admit and discharge pet patients
  • Handling invoicing, billing, creating estimates, and processing payments
  • Providing compassionate care including feeding and walking patients
  • Maintaining cleanliness in reception, pet holding areas, and common spaces

An certification from a Veterinary Assistant (VA) or Veterinary Assistant Office Administration (VAOA) program is considered an asset.
